To learn how to tune a flute effectively, you can start by using a tuner to match the pitch of each note to the correct frequency. Adjust the position of the headjoint and the tension of the embouchure to achieve the desired pitch. Practice regularly to develop your ear for tuning and improve your technique.
To tune a flute properly, use a tuner to adjust the position of the headjoint cork until the note produced by playing the flute matches the desired pitch.
To tune your flute for optimal performance, use a tuner to adjust the position of the headjoint cork or the length of the headjoint to achieve the correct pitch. Experiment with different positions until the flute is in tune with a reference pitch.
To effectively clean a flute at home, disassemble the flute and use a cleaning rod with a soft cloth to remove moisture and debris from the inside of the flute. Use a cleaning cloth to wipe down the outside of the flute. Avoid using water or harsh chemicals on the flute. Regularly clean the flute to maintain its condition and sound quality.
To clean a flute effectively, disassemble it carefully and use a cleaning rod with a cloth to wipe the inside of the flute body. Clean the keys with a soft cloth and a small brush. Use a cleaning cloth to wipe the outside of the flute. Avoid using water or harsh chemicals on the flute.

There is no Poke Flute item in Pokemon Silver. Instead, the player can have their radio upgraded in Lavender Town. It will then play a station that can play the Poke Flute tune.

To effectively clean your flute using a flute cleaning swab, gently insert the swab into the flute's body and carefully pull it through to remove moisture and debris. Repeat this process a few times until the flute is clean and dry. Be sure to use a clean swab each time to prevent buildup and maintain the flute's condition.
